Ben Affleck and Jennifer Garner Divorce Due To Cheating

He Ben Unfaithful?

While we were surpassed to hear reports of Ben Affleck and Jennifer Garner getting divorced a few weeks ago, we were even more surprised this morning to hear that Affleck allegedly may have cheated on Garner. These details are coming from a new US Weekly exclusive.

Ben Affleck and Jennifer Garner Divorce Due To Cheating

According to an insider who spoke to the magazine, Affleck “admitted to cheating” within the last year.

While Garner initially kicked him out, she “eventually decided to forgive him.”

US Weekly did also speak to a source close to Affleck who denied the cheating.

Regardless, there were clearly issues, as another insider dished that “she tried to leave him a few times, but he would beg her to stay.”

“She always fought against the urge to throw her hands up in the air and walk away,” another insider added. “They’ve been on the brink of splitting up many times before, but it’s Jennifer’s worst nightmare for their children. Her biggest desire has always been to keep the family together.”

We truly feel for all the parties involved during this hard time.

Prior to splitting up, the couple had allegedly tried couples therapy, although it’s clear it didn’t work.

More Celebrity Stories: 

Donald Trump Fired From NBC

Bobbi Kristina Hospice Begins

John Stamos DUI Thanks Fans For Support